Market Segmentation and Product Innovation
The Singapore wheatgrass market can be categorized based on form (powder, liquid, and tablet), distribution channel (online, supermarkets, health stores), and application (food & beverages, pharmaceuticals, and personal care). Among these, the powdered form dominates due to its longer shelf life and versatility in smoothies and shakes. Liquid wheatgrass, however, is seeing growing adoption for its instant consumption benefits.
Manufacturers are innovating to differentiate their products through organic certification, sustainable sourcing, and value-added formulations. For example, wheatgrass blends with spirulina, moringa, or matcha are gaining traction for offering multiple health benefits in one product. Singapore’s consumers, known for their preference for premium and high-quality products, are also responding positively to locally grown or sustainably imported wheatgrass varieties.
Role of Retail and E-Commerce Expansion
Supermarkets such as FairPrice, Cold Storage, and health-focused outlets like Nature’s Farm continue to be leading retail channels for wheatgrass products. However, online sales are witnessing the fastest growth. E-commerce platforms like Shopee and Lazada, along with direct-to-consumer brands, are offering competitive pricing, detailed product information, and customer reviews—factors that build trust in this niche category. Subscription models and bundle packs are also gaining attention among regular consumers.
Challenges and Future Outlook
Despite positive growth prospects, the Singapore wheatgrass market faces certain challenges. High production and import costs can make premium wheatgrass products relatively expensive. Moreover, consumer skepticism regarding exaggerated health claims can limit market penetration. Educating consumers through transparent labeling and clinical validation will be vital for long-term trust.
